What you'll do
We’re looking for a Produce Specialist to join our team here in Aotearoa reporting to our Head of Product Innovation and Technology. The Produce Specialist will work collaboratively together with internal stakeholders and suppliers, to bring products to market. They are the subject matter expert, with the technical capability to provide the business with sound guidance and help educate and support the wider process technology discipline.
You will be responsible for:
- Product and Packaging knowledge for driving product development successfully - product origin, characteristics, seasonality, variety, shelf life, packaging formats.
- Setting Quality standards through defining clear product attributes, and continually benchmarking and challenging standards to maintain clear differences.
- Adhere to the NPD process for product development, completing all relevant documentation, and ensuring on time delivery of the agreed NPD plan.
- Creation and management of produce specifications and reviewing artwork and labelling checks.
What you’ll bring
To succeed in this role you will need to have in-depth working knowledge of the produce sector and be able to implement legal and regulatory requirements that enable us to provide compliant products, product claims and accurate labels. You have knowledge of processing/packaging processes and impact on Cost of Goods, coupled with solid organisational and project management skills. You demonstrate commitment for excellence and setting of standards, while having demonstrated experience with diverse stakeholder interaction. A tertiary qualification in a food-related field (minimum 3-year diploma or degree) is required, along with at least 5 years of experience in produce related quality discipline or a relevant discipline within a complex produce environment.
